Justin M. Majewski

Justin M. Majewski is an associate attorney at Michigan Justice, focusing primarily on appellate practice, municipal law, and criminal law.

Mr. Majewski graduated magna cum laude from Western Michigan University Thomas M. Cooley Law School. Mr. Majewski finished law school ranked second in his graduating class with a 3.97 GPA. During law school, Mr. Majewski served on WMU-Cooley’s Law Review as Executive Subcite Editor, which is a position on the Voting Board of Editors. For two consecutive years, Mr. Majewski was selected to represent WMU-Cooley in the New York City Bar Association’s National Moot Court Competition, which simulates briefing and oral argument in the United States Supreme Court. Mr. Majewski also served as a teaching assistant for the Advocacy, Business Organizations, and Contracts II courses.
